ksort()函数在处理大量数据时性能如何优化

avatar
作者
猴君
阅读量:0

当处理大量数据时,可以通过以下方法优化ksort()函数的性能:

  1. 减少不必要的数据操作:在对数据进行排序之前,先确保数据的准确性和完整性,避免不必要的数据操作和重复排序。

  2. 使用合适的数据结构:选择合适的数据结构来存储数据,例如使用数组或关联数组来存储数据,以便更快地进行排序操作。

  3. 使用适当的排序算法:根据数据量和数据类型的特点,选择合适的排序算法来实现排序操作,例如使用快速排序、归并排序或插入排序等算法。

  4. 分批处理数据:如果数据量很大,可以将数据分成多个批次进行排序,以减少内存占用和提高排序效率。

  5. 使用缓存机制:对于需要频繁排序的数据,可以使用缓存机制来存储已排序的数据,以避免重复排序操作。

  6. 并行处理数据:对于可以并行处理的数据,可以使用多线程或多进程来同时处理数据,以提高排序效率。

通过以上方法,可以有效地提高ksort()函数在处理大量数据时的性能和效率。

广告一刻

为您即时展示最新活动产品广告消息,让您随时掌握产品活动新动态!